Operation Encompass - Supporting Children at Brentfield Primary School
Brentfield Primary School takes part in Operation Encompass. Operation Encompass is a national programme which helps schools support children who may have experienced domestic abuse.
What happens?
If the police attend a domestic incident where a Brentfield pupil is present, the police will inform the school before the next school day. The information is sent securely to the Designated Safeguarding Lead (DSL).
Why this is important:
This helps us to:
- Act quickly
- Support children sensitively and appropriately
Confidentiality:
- Information is private and secure
- Staff are informed on a need-to-know basis only
Our Safeguarding Duty:
Taking part in Operation Encompass is part of our legal duty to keep children safe and promote their welfare.
